Kick Start Movements - activities for children

Kick Start Movements – activities for children

“Kick Start Movements is an all-new physical and nutritional programme for kids. The brainchild of two GAA stars (William Lowry and Mícheál McCarthy), Kick Start Movements, is an innovative new way to encourage physical activity, healthy food awareness and social interaction in children, delivered through childcare facilities in Ireland”.

Annette Smith founder of Tennis4kids with Judy Murray discussing the benefits of tennis for childrens’ development

“Discover the benefits of Mini Tennis – Tennis4kids is a uniquely designed tennis programme for children aged between 5 and 12. Children of all abilities and levels of co-ordination will fall in love with tennis in a safe, supportive setting. Smaller courts, softer balls and perfect-sized rackets for smaller hands mean children can develop at their own pace, having fun in an enjoyable environment.”

StartUpBallymun is an initiative of the Dublin City Council economic development unit in Ballymun, north Dublin. And is part of the promotion of enterprise and business startups in Ballymun and nearby. Liam BarryEconomic Development Officer, Ballymun Town Civic Alliance, Dublin City Council
